Abstract

This paper reports a reconnaissance result of structural damage to school gymnasiums caused by the 2016 Kumamoto Earthquake. A total of 328 gymnasiums built in Kumamoto and Oita prefectures has been investigated. 55% of investigated gymnasiums were slightly damaged or not damaged while 17% of investigated gymnasiums were seriously damaged. In most of the seriously damaged gymnasiums, fracture of vertical braces as well as edge failure of concrete at column bases or steel roof joints were observed. Especially, edge failure of concrete at steel roof joints were dominant regardless of the construction year and whether seismic retrofit has been done.
